His journey began on September 28, 1977, in Sulphur Springs, TX with his parents, Richard and Mary Helen Weir Moss.  Danny grew up in Sulphur Springs, TX, and Phoenix, AZ, with his sister Dana Moss Waggoner.

Always ready for an “adventure” with his love of Planes, Trains, Cars, and Big Trucks since he was a little boy, he entered a career in the transportation industry as a CDL driver at the age of 20.  He traveled lanes all around the United States, mostly from the east coast to the west coast.  His favorite places were the beaches of California.

Danny’s infectious smile, mischievous twinkle in his blue eyes, and kind heart significantly impacted all who met him.

Danny was preceded in death by his father, Richard Moss.  Danny is survived by his Daughter Madison Moss, Mother Mary Helen Weir Moss, Sister Dana Moss Waggoner, Grandmother Micki Moss, and Uncle Kenneth Moss of AZ.  Aunts, Uncles, Cousins, and Friends from Texas to California.  Also, Special Love Kelly Moss.

One of Danny’s favorite scriptures was 2 Corinthians 4:16-18, King James version:

For which cause we faint not; but through our outward man perish, yet the inward man is renewed day by day.  For our light affliction, which is but for a moment, worketh for us a far more exceeding and eternal weight of glory.  While we look not at the things which are seen, but at the things which are not seen: for the things which are seen are temporal; but the things which are not seen are eternal.

Danny’s favorite quote:  it’s all about Jesus.

His new journey began July 9, 2022.
